Changing the Effect Type

.........................................................................

You can change the effect type selection in the first EFFECT page

(page 4 of the display). Select an effect type using the

EFFECT TYPE ▲

and ▼ buttons, or highlight the

EFFECT TYPE function and use the data

dial or the [–] and [+] buttons.

Effect Type
• Settings: See table on page 219.
• Basic setting: Depends on voice.

You can also use the left and right LCD buttons to select one of the

effect types listed in the display screen.

To reset the effect type to its basic setting, simultaneously press the

EFFECT TYPE ▲ and ▼ buttons or the [–] and [+] buttons.

The selected effect type is highlighted.

Because the basic setting of the effect type depends on the voice, the

effect type may change automatically when you select a different voice.

• The effect type selection affects all

keyboard parts. Different settings
cannot be made for each part.

• When the basic setting of the [EF-

FECT] button is ON for two or three
voices selected in Dual and/or Split
mode, the Clavinova will automatically
select the most appropriate effect type
and set the effect depth (page 60) for
each part to an appropriate level.

• Depending on the selected voice, the

depth of the effect may sound stronger
or weaker, even though the same
effect type is selected.

• If both the [EFFECT] button and the

[REVERB] and/or [CHORUS] buttons
are turned on, all effects will be ap-
plied.
